Activities

To provide grants and financial assistance for educational purposes to young people, within the Dunstable area, whose parents are in sympathy with the aims of the Church of England and other Christian churches. It is also responsible for the upkeep and maintenance of Chews House and the Old Library (now The Little Theatre).

Objects: 1. Assistance In Apprenticing (one Quarter). 2. Scholarships And Other Awards For Boys And Girls Who Are Not Dissenters From The Church Of England For The Benefit Of The Inhabitants In The Area Of The Boroughs Of Dunstable And Luton, Rural District Of Luton And The Parish Of Edlesborough.
